Major: Video/Media (This Major's Salary over time)
Getting a decent professor in any department is like flipping a coin. It's truly a 50/50 chance if you're going to get an awesome teacher or absolutely horrible teacher. The Film/Video department is a 1 out of 8 chance to get a good professor. Most of them are so egocentric it makes almost any class unbearable. Info Tech classes are a toss up. It's been 50/50. But you can learn a lot even from bad profs. The students were great. The University as a whole was annoying because all of the departments think they are better than the others, and refuse to talk one another. You, have to force them to work anything out. I ended up dropping out because I couldn't get the different departments to work things out when I wanted to change majors.
